Output 99ab89355bc4cba2002461fdd4d22c4da15eecb4cead27fb56828ad90fab3f0d:10

value
1738423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e97ac6aef7a9161f07b75b051dd0dd45d7ef61d OP_EQUAL
address
37PyWtzZS14GLPAXWuc9p1ta893h4Jwbvg
transaction
99ab89355bc4cba2002461fdd4d22c4da15eecb4cead27fb56828ad90fab3f0d
confirmations
234742
spent
true